- The Davis High School Madrigals are an auditioned group of 32 high school sophomores, juniors and seniors from Davis, California, USA who perform a wide variety of music dating from the 15th century to the present. Formed in 1966, this highly accomplished class demands the best of these young musicians’ talents. Each Madrigal designs their own costume interpreting the dress of the upper class of late 15th through mid-16th century England.

- The Spare Changer
- Join us as we explore the concerns of the sheltered and unsheltered poor as well as the insights and recommendations of social services providers seeking solutions. Monthly themes range from Affordable Housing to Causes and Common Misconceptions About The Homeless to Living Paycheck to Paycheck to Disenfranchisement From Mainstream Society to Homelessness By Choice to Quality of Life infractions... and more. Often submissions to The Spare Changer are penned by long time members of the homeless community, yet many are not. Some articles are actually a compendium of questionnaire responses while others are verbatim dictations of comments expressed by the sheltered and unsheltered poor blessed with compassion if not with polished writing skill. Still other articles and entries are submitted by administrators and volunteers of non-profits and governmental agencies with a mandate to ease the strain of those of us living on a fixed budget or no budget at all. "There but for the grace of God go I" emerges as the one common thread you will see underlying their motivation to work so hard in meeting the challenges of the marginally served.
